Organic Mulch Installation in Ventura County, CA
Organic mulch installation is a service that involves applying natural materials such as bark, wood chips, straw, or compost to garden beds, trees, and landscaped areas. This process helps improve soil health, retain moisture, suppress weeds, and enhance the overall appearance of outdoor spaces. Property owners often request this service for landscape renovation projects, garden bed refreshes, or new planting areas, aiming to create a healthier and more attractive environment around their homes.
Before requesting organic mulch installation, property owners typically want to understand the different types of mulch available, their benefits, and suitability for specific landscaping needs. It’s also helpful to consider the appropriate depth for mulch application, the timing of installation, and any ongoing maintenance requirements. Clarifying these details ensures the mulch serves its intended purpose effectively and complements the existing landscape design.

Organic Mulch Installation Questions
What is organic mulch installation? It involves applying natural materials like wood chips, bark, or compost to garden beds to improve soil health and appearance.
What types of projects benefit from organic mulch? Flower beds, shrub borders, vegetable gardens, and landscape borders often benefit from organic mulch installation.
How does organic mulch help a landscape? It helps retain soil moisture, suppress weeds, regulate soil temperature, and add nutrients as it decomposes.
What should property owners consider before installing organic mulch? Consider the mulch type, depth, and placement to ensure optimal benefits and avoid issues like pests or mold.
